This is from an article I posted a few days by Matt Maiocco:

Carrier appears to be in good position to win the backup job to Vernon Davis after putting together a strong start to training camp. The price of a trade might be steep after the 49ers awarded him a $400,000 signing bonus in the offseasson as part of an extension that pays him reasonable salaries of $585,00, $800,000 and $950,000 the next three seasons. Carrier has appeared in 16 games the past two seasons with the 49ers and has nine receptions for 105 yards
